Why
did NeuStar send me an email?
As registry operator for the ccTLD ,us, NeuStar has an
agreement with the United States Department of
Commerce that requires them to perform random
"spot checks" on registrations in the usTLD
to ensure that they comply with the US Nexus
Requirements. A copy of these requirements can be
found at www.neustar.us/policies/docs/ustld_nexus_requirements.pdf.

What
does the Nexus Confirmation email mean?
If you received a Nexus Confirmation email from
NeuStar, you need to prove that you comply with the
Nexus requirements. This means that you need to prove
that you comply with one of the following:
Category 1 - You are a US citizen or permanent
resident
Category 2 - You are a US business or organization.
Category 3 - You are a "foreign entity
organization that has a bona fide presence in the
United States of America or any of its possessions or
territories."

What
do I have to do?
You must reply to the email you received from NeuStar,
giving a written response describing how you qualify
under one or some of the Nexus categories.

What
happens if I do not reply to the Nexus Confirmation
email?
If you do not respond to the email or are unable to
explain or demonstrate that you meet any of the Nexus
Requirements, you will risk losing the domain name in
question. You will be given 30 days to demonstrate to
the registry operator that you do comply with the
Nexus. If you do not demonstrate compliance within
this timeframe the registry operator will delete the
domain from the registry database. You will not
receive a refund for the registration fee. Once your
registration of the domain has been deleted, someone
else may register the domain name for their use.

Will
I get a refund?
If your registration is deleted because you failed to
demonstrate that you meet the US Nexus Requirements,
there will be no refund of registration fees made to
registrants or registrars.

How
often can I expect to get this?
You may receive a maximum of one Nexus Confirmation
email per domain registration in the usTLD. However,
not all registrants will receive a Nexus confirmation
email. NeuStar will only perform spot-checks so it is
possible that you may not receive a Nexus Confirmation
email.

How
will Neustar select registrations for the Nexus
Confirmation email?
Each week Neustar will select a random sample of
registrations.
